Connecticut Health Clinic Hack Affects Nearly 1.1 Million
1 hour 58 minutes ago
Health Records of Children, Deceased Patients Among Compromised Data
Community Health Center, which has a dozen primary care, dental and other clinics in Connecticut, is notifying nearly 1.1 million people - including pediatric patients and their parents and guardians - that their information was potentially stolen in a cyberattack detected earlier this month.

Critical UK Government Systems at High Risk, Warn Auditors
1 hour 58 minutes ago
Governmental Agencies Won't Meet 2025 Goal of Bolster Cybersecurity
The British government fell short of its goal of significantly fortifying civilian IT systems to withstand cyberattacks by 2025, warned auditors in a report highlighting that much of officialdom runs on legacy systems. Nearly half of the government IT budget goes to keeping legacy systems running.

Too Little, Too Late: Australian Banks Lag on Scam Controls
13 hours 58 minutes ago
Banks Shift Blame to Social Media, Telecoms While Scam Victims Pay the Price
If you're the victim of a scam in Australia, the chances of being reimbursed for your stolen funds are low. In fact, the AFCA ruled in favor of full reimbursement for victims in only 4.8% of its cases in 2024, highlighting the difficulty consumers face in disputing fraud-related losses with banks.

NY Blood Center Attack Disrupts Suppliers in Several States
1 day 2 hours ago
Ransomware Attack on the Center Is the Latest Assault on Blood Supply Chain
A New York blood center and its divisions that serves hospitals in several states are dealing with ransomware attack disrupting donations and other activities. The attack - the latest assault on a blood supplier - comes just days after the center declared a blood shortage emergency.

Attackers Could Gain Control of 2 Flawed Patient Monitors
1 day 2 hours ago
Feds Warn Flaws Could Lead to 'Simultaneous Exploitation' of All Devices
U.S. federal authorities are warning that cybersecurity vulnerabilities in two brands of patient monitors used in healthcare settings and in patients' homes can allow remote attackers to take control of the devices when connected to the internet, posing safety and data privacy concerns.

Nation State Groups Exploit Gemini AI App
1 day 2 hours ago
Google Says Iranian and Chinese Threat Group the Most Active
Iranian and Chinese threat actors are using Google's artificial intelligence application Gemini for vulnerability scanning and reconnaissance activities, with some attempting to bypass security guardrails of the application, the computing giant disclosed.

IT Services Vendor Hack Affects 293,000 AHN Patients
1 day 23 hours ago
7 Proposed Class Actions Filed Against Allegheny Health Network and IntraSystems
A Pittsburgh-based healthcare system and its Massachusetts-based IT services firm are facing at least seven proposed federal class action lawsuits involving a data theft - reported on Jan. 17 - affecting about 293,000 people. The hack is the latest major breach involving a business associate.

European Regulators Probe DeepSeek
1 day 23 hours ago
Data Storage in China Sparks Privacy Concerns
Italian data regulator Garante launched an inquiry into data storage and processing practices of Chinese generative AI model DeepSeek following the Friday public debut of its R1 reasoning model. The DeepSeek app is no longer available in the Apple and Google app stores in Italy.
